Hotel Hilton Garden Inn New Orleans Airport - Kenner - New Orleans (La) United States - Photos
» Hotel Hilton Garden Inn New Orleans Airport - Kenner - New Orleans (La) United States
Hotel Hilton Garden Inn New Orleans Airport - Kenner - New Orleans (La) United States - Search and Book Hotel
4535 Williams Boulevard Kenner 70065 New Orleans (La)
Hotels 3 Stars United States